barque Emily, 580 tons, Captain William Wilson, from London & Plymouth 4th May 1849, arrived at Port Adelaide, South Australia 8th August 1849

South Australian Register Saturday 11th August 1849

Wednesday August 8th, 1849:- the barque Emily, 580 tons, Stewart, Master (Captain William Wilson), from London and Plymouth.
Passengers: Revd. Edward Bayfield, wife & three children ; Henry Butcher & wife ; Robert Stirling Esq. and William Moire Esq. surgeon-superintendent, in the cabin. . . .
. . . There were 3 births during the voyage, Mrs. Hough a son, Mrs. Thomas Dalton a daughter and Mrs. James G. Simms a son. There were 9 deaths as follows, H.W. Simms, 2 ; W. Axon, 1 ; M. Axon, 2 ; M. Ashby, 1 ; E. Jarrett, one day ; E. Jarrett, 29 ; E. Yarwood, 1 ; A.E. Simms, 1 ; Jane Blair, 20 years of consumption.
15th ship from England to S.A. with government passengers for 1849 ; 3 births and 9 deaths on the passage ; William Moire / Moir Esq., surgeon-superintendent.
